Lars Ingebrigtsen <larsi@gnus.org> writes:
> There's been some discussion off-list about adding simple image
> manipulation functions to Emacs, and there's really only three
> transforms that are in scope for Emacs: Cropping, rotating and resizing.
I think we should have a special `image-edit-mode' to support this. We
could have a keybinding to go to between that mode and `image-mode' (say
`C-x C-q').
In the short-term, I think `image-mode' should stop pretending it can
edit images by making `image-save' into an obsolete alias for
`write-file'.
